According to Mary Ainsworth's strange situation procedure, what are the different types of attachment styles between infants and caregivers?

The different types of attachment styles between infants and caregivers are secure, avoidant, ambivalent, and disorganised. Secure attachment involves a balance between exploration and seeking proximity to the caregiver, while the other types are characterised by different patterns of distress and avoidance.
